Minister seeks details of varsities’ teaching, non-teaching staff ratio

Sindh Minister for Universities and Boards Muhammad Ali Malkani has desired to have the details of teaching and non-teaching employees’ ratio in government universities and institutes across Sindh within seven days.

Now, Secretary of Boards and Universities Department Abbas Baloch has written a letter to the heads of universities and institutes and sought details within seven days.

It should be noted that in all government universities and institutes in the province, teachers have been appointed on important administrative posts, including those of registrar, controller of examinations and director research, on an acting or part-time basis instead of being given permanent appointments. The responsibilities of the posts are affected due to which both teaching and administrative affairs are affected.
